Output ec6923a3e3f433bd65254bbcd18cd8221c6fb42e659be989ce7d2eac0009dd2a:7

value
5032455278
script pubkey
OP_0 OP_PUSHBYTES_32 bff432ff19ee6a0e61864f21a03964d726e17ae2d00c52560fc3aa3f06072c7c
address
bc1qhl6r9lceae4qucvxfus6qwty6unwz7hz6qx9y4s0cw4r7ps8937qwt93zl
transaction
ec6923a3e3f433bd65254bbcd18cd8221c6fb42e659be989ce7d2eac0009dd2a
confirmations
13631
spent
true